Transaction c62b64a89859322721cb17940a9ae0f8a535ed882e2de9836dbed7f14b43b594
1 Input
1 Output
-
c62b64a89859322721cb17940a9ae0f8a535ed882e2de9836dbed7f14b43b594:0
- value
- 589743
- script pubkey
- OP_0 OP_PUSHBYTES_20 0970e3eab8ded05dbd66294177829b35ac7be392
- address
- bc1qp9cw864cmmg9m0tx99qh0q5mxkk8hcujfm6wma